SOURCE: Unable to shift from park into drive

there is a solenoid that releases the shifter when you step on the brake pedal.there is by the shifter a little tab that can be popped out with a small screwdriver,and using your key,put into the hole and the mechanical device will release the shifter.
it is called a shift lock override

1992 toyota camry v6 auto. can't move shifter. car starts and ste

Car must be on and brake pedal depressed to shift. If you have no brake lights then the car doesn't know the pedal is depressed and will not shift out of park. This car has an interlock overide on the shifter console, push it and it will come out of Park. You will need a brake light switch tho.
